Dentinho and Manor Solomon were on the score-sheet as Real Madrid were condemned to yet another loss in the Champions League on Tuesday night.

Shakhtar Donetsk claimed another shock victory against Los Blancos with a 2-0 victory at home. That means they did the double over the Spanish giants in the Champions League group stages.

The result means Real Madrid are in danger of a shock Champions League exit should Inter defeat Shakhtar Donetsk next week and they fail to beat leaders Borussia Monchengladbach in the closing fixture of the group stage.

Real Madrid early opportunities to take the lead in the game via Asensio and Benzema but both failed to effectively take their chances.

Shakhtar lost Moraes to injury after he collided with Raphael Varane in the first half. It was a bland first half for the Ukranian side who failed to register a single shot on target in the first period.

In the second half, it seemed like Real Madrid were primed to take the lead when Benzema created a great chance for Nacho who could only see his headed effort go wide.

Shakhtar replied not long after and got their first goal in the 57th minute when Viktor Kovalenko slipped in a pass past Mendy and Varane, leaving Dentinho with space to fire home the lead.

Real Madrid soon conceded another via a counter attacking move to put any hopes of a comeback to bed. Solomon sent his effort past Courtois from 18 yards in the 82nd minute.

Dentinho and company will host Minai in the weekend before a crunch clash against Inter on Wednesday. Real Madrid will face Sevilla on Saturday before hosting Gladbach next week.
